S2000GT:
My 04 was going to be kept stock. That plan didn't work out too well! There really isnt any one bodykit out there that I liked in its entirety, so I decided to take the best parts from various tuners and make my own style. The main parts are Airwalker sides, Mugen 3 piece wing, Top Secret CF Diffusor on an Ings+1 rear and a Top Secret front bumper. I have just finished my full CF audio install using products from JL Audio and Alpine. Wheels are powdercoated Black Chrome, along with most of the engine bay. This car is all about the little details - the shaved door locks, the shaved trunk, the stubby antenna, the painted sidemarkers, the cleared 04 headlights etc - i get a kick when people just notice something on the car they have been looking at for weeks! In the works: new 18s are being finished in black chrome and Ill be installing a cusco cage over the winter. If you guys like what I have done so far - VOTE FOR ME!

Rogue3308:
I appreciate being nominated this month. I have realy gone with "the clean" look for my car. The car is a 2002 Suzuka Blue. I have Mille Evo wheels with Kumho tires, Comptech exhaust and CAI (Thanks Rich). Calipers are painted silver with G2 paint. OEM Front lip,rear wing and hard top (Thanks HARDTOGUY.COM). I have Grill Tech 3 piece grills (Thanks Tim) with a DOHC badge from my man Scott Evil's old Acura Integra. Lights are cleared with Rick's JDM Diffusers (Thanks DAVE1)and clear side markers. Mastergrade cooling plate (Thanks Popeye), Comptech STB and oil cap (again Hardtopguy.com) , Optima battery and Tien hood dampers painted blue (by me). Sound system consists of Alpine HU, SoundStream and Phoenix Gold Amps pushing Infinity Components and an Alphasonic Sub Woofer.(Thanks PAS2KNUT)
Voodoo shift knob and 2004 radio door finish her off. I have enjoyed shaping the car to my liking. I am not real big on vented hoods,large wings or wide body kits. I enjoy the clean look I have now. My only other mod would be to lower the car an inch or 2. Maybe Santa will bring me some coilovers for Christmas. Thanks again for the nomination and good luck to everyone who is participating. These cars are so much fun.

Jakub2000:
My car is a 2003 EUDM painted in custom black metalic, powered by a LoveFab turbo kit runing 8psi and 325whp. I am trying to improve, but not to change the classic look of this car, shaving off all the badges and making the side indicators nearly invisible to let the eye focus on the pure lines of the body. A Top Secret bumper,hood and hood lifters set this car apart, rolling on 17" VOLK CE28N and throwing flames from a custom made dual 3" exhaust. Head lamp housing and dashboard trim are painted to match the color of the car. I keep it clean and fast instead of rice and last.
